When it comes to increasing diversion from landfills, many municipalities could learn from Toronto.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/p&gt; &lt;p&gt;&lt;a href="http://lfpress.ca/newsstand/Opinion/Editorials/2006/07/04/1666765.html"&gt;Read more&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t; &lt;/p&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/27654175-115210453573509921?l=london-ontario.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://london-ontario.blogspot.com/feeds/115210453573509921/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='https://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=27654175&amp;postID=115210453573509921' title='0 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/27654175/posts/default/115210453573509921'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/27654175/posts/default/115210453573509921'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://london-ontario.blogspot.com/2006/07/wheres-garbage-going.html' title='Where&apos;s the garbage going?'/><author><name>Gingin</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/13957493271837666920</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:extendedProperty xmlns:gd='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005' name='OpenSocialUserId' value='02795681187340123832'/></author><thr:total xmlns:thr='http://purl.org/syndication/thread/1.0'>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-27654175.post-115037331584381140</id><published>2006-06-15T08:07:00.000-04:00</published><updated>2006-06-15T08:08:36.210-04:00</updated><title type='text'>Ivey Honoured By Canadian Blood Services</title><content type='html'>Canadian Blood Services has selected the Richard Ivey School of Business as an outstanding Corporate Partner, honouring the school's ongoing support for the better part of two decades.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;For the past 20 years, Ivey has been involved in the Blood Program and since 1998 have been a strategic partner with Canadian Blood Services. The school offers annual blood donor clinics which are facilitated through Ivey Connects - a student-led initiative that is focused on building stronger ties between the local community and the Ivey student body.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;In addition, Canadian Blood Services has taken advantage of Ivey Connects' Community Consulting Projects and in 2004, at no cost to the organization, students conducted a study on the London blood clinic to determine best practices for donor recruitment as well as corporate marketing strategies.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Last summer, in partnership with London Life and the London Life Community Internship Program, Ivey Connects also provided Canadian Blood Services with an MBA intern, Stephen Leung, who helped develop enhanced donor recruitment strategies.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;"The Richard Ivey School of Business has exceeded all expectations of a community partner and continues to be a highly valued resource for Southern Ontario that is worthy of national recognition," says Judy Compton, Regional Director, Southern Ontario, Canadian Blood Services.&lt;br /&gt;Ivey Connects allows students the opportunity to appreciate the School's mission to produce leaders who contribute to the societies in which they operate.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Each year, in addition to pro-bono consulting work and internships, the students coordinate food drives and toy drives, and, as part of Community Action Days, they spend a full day volunteering within the local non-profit sector.&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/27654175-115037331584381140?l=london-ontario.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://london-ontario.blogspot.com/feeds/115037331584381140/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='https://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=27654175&amp;postID=115037331584381140' title='0 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/27654175/posts/default/115037331584381140'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/27654175/posts/default/115037331584381140'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://london-ontario.blogspot.com/2006/06/ivey-honoured-by-canadian-blood.html' title='Ivey Honoured By Canadian Blood Services'/><author><name>Gingin</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/13957493271837666920</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:extendedProperty xmlns:gd='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005' name='OpenSocialUserId' value='02795681187340123832'/></author><thr:total xmlns:thr='http://purl.org/syndication/thread/1.0'>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-27654175.post-114849054286511849</id><published>2006-05-24T13:00:00.000-04:00</published><updated>2006-05-24T13:09:02.936-04:00</updated><title type='text'>Online scams - get paid to surf</title><content type='html'>Well this entire topic had me baffled for over a month.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;How could companies possibly pay me to read my email or how could I get a free X-Box or HD Television?&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Well after lots of digging I now have a degree in Murphy's Law School. &lt;p&gt;&lt;a href="http://lfpress.ca/newsstand/News/Local/2006/05/08/1570063.html"&gt;Read the article:&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/27654175-114719712285423110?l=london-ontario.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://london-ontario.blogspot.com/feeds/114719712285423110/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='https://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=27654175&amp;postID=114719712285423110' title='0 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/27654175/posts/default/114719712285423110'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/27654175/posts/default/114719712285423110'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://london-ontario.blogspot.com/2006/05/skepticism-greets-jobs-guarantee-for.html' title='Skepticism greets jobs guarantee for nursing grads'/><author><name>Gingin</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/13957493271837666920</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:extendedProperty xmlns:gd='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005' name='OpenSocialUserId' value='02795681187340123832'/></author><thr:total xmlns:thr='http://purl.org/syndication/thread/1.0'>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-27654175.post-114719697707908568</id><published>2006-05-09T13:49:00.000-04:00</published><updated>2006-05-09T13:49:37.450-04:00</updated><title type='text'>Getting Back Canadian Doctors</title><content type='html'>&lt;p&gt;Dr. David Bach the new head of the Ontario Medical Association has made getting more doctors into the province his first priority.&lt;/p&gt; &lt;p&gt;     Bach is trying to get back over nine thousand physicians who were trained in Canada, but now work in the United States. &lt;/p&gt; &lt;p&gt;    Over the weekend the radiologist from London, Ontario, was elected to replace Dr. Greg Flynn as head of the association.&lt;/p&gt; &lt;p&gt; Bach says though measures have been taken to increase medical school enrollment in the province, he says more needs to be done right now.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/p&gt; &lt;p&gt;&lt;a href="http://www.cfra.com/headlines/index.asp?cat=1&amp;amp;nid=38957"&gt;Read the entire article on the CFRA web site.&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/27654175-114719697707908568?l=london-ontario.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://london-ontario.blogspot.com/feeds/114719697707908568/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='https://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=27654175&amp;postID=114719697707908568' title='0 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/27654175/posts/default/114719697707908568'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/27654175/posts/default/114719697707908568'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://london-ontario.blogspot.com/2006/05/getting-back-canadian-doctors.html' title='Getting Back Canadian Doctors'/><author><name>Gingin</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/13957493271837666920</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:extendedProperty xmlns:gd='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005' name='OpenSocialUserId' value='02795681187340123832'/></author><thr:total xmlns:thr='http://purl.org/syndication/thread/1.0'>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-27654175.post-114694612122360826</id><published>2006-05-06T16:05:00.000-04:00</published><updated>2006-05-06T16:08:41.236-04:00</updated><title type='text'>London Ontario Business Directory</title><content type='html'>&lt;b style="font-family: georgia;"&gt;&lt;u&gt;&lt;a href="http://www.londonlink.ca/london_ontario.htm"&gt;The City of London&lt;/a&gt;
